SUB PAY/ UNEMPLOYMENT
DETERMINATION: Sub pay will be automatic for members who have
been laid off any time in the last 52 weeks prior to this layoff
week, and have already received unemployment compensation during
this past year.
WAITING WEEK INFORMATION:
Members who were on layoff status and serving their waiting week
will be denied unemployment and must take their ODJFS Determination
Notice to Human Resources to file for sub pay for your waiting week.
The ODJFS no longer mails waiting week notifications.
You must go to the ODJFS web site at http://unemployment.ohio.gov,
and then go to the menu options on the left side of the home page
under UNEMPLOYED WORKERS. Those who filed their claim on the
internet need to click on EXISTING ACCOUNT LOGIN. Members who filed
over the phone need to click on CREATE A NEW ACCOUNT. Read the
release of information and then click on I AGREE in the lower left
hand corner.
Enter your Social Security number in
the top box and then enter your pin number. Then, log in and go to
the VIEW CORRESPONDENCE inbox. Highlight the circle to the left to
view the UNEMPLOYMENT BENEFIT PAYMENT, click on the VIEW DETAILS
box, click on OPEN FILE DOWNLOAD, then print your unemployment
benefit payment documents and take BOTH PAGES to the
Human Resources Department to sign up for your sub pay.
Signing up for sub this time will start your auto sub for one year
in the event of future layoffs.

U.A.W. FAMILY SCHOLARSHIP:
Applications are available at the union hall for the 2008 Walter and
May Reuther U.A.W. Family Scholarship being held at the U.A.W.
Education Center at Black Lake in Onaway, Michigan on the weeks of
July 6-11, July 13-18, and July 20-25. A $50.00 refundable
registration fee must be submitted with the application. Members
must use vacation time, personal time or take a union leave of
absence to attend.
